### Step 4: Enable idempotency keys

Tillgate payment retries now require an idempotency key per charge attempt. Generate the key client-side before the first attempt; reuse it on every retry. The gateway stores keys in the idem_keys table with a 48-hour TTL. Do not regenerate keys on timeout — that causes duplicate charges. Backfill existing in-flight retries with synthetic keys using the migration script. Run the script against the payments database using the connection string below.

replica DSN, kajep-yahag: mssql://praok_svc:iF@db-8d68.plorvaio.local:5432/eliion

### v3.4.2 — Health check key rotation

Quick one: the Larkmont load balancer now hits `/healthz/deep` instead of the old shallow ping, so flapping nodes actually get drained. While we were in there, we rotated the credentials the probes use to authenticate to backends, since the old ones dated back to the Quillen migration. Probe configs shipped already — just update your deploy signing to the new key below.

signing key of bagap-yawep = bky13_TbfT6ZMUoGJo2

## Runbook: Gateway rate limiting — Corvid internal API

The Corvid gateway enforces per-client token buckets; limits apply after authentication, so unauthenticated floods fall to the edge tier instead. When tuning, note that lowering the burst ceiling affects batch jobs from the Ostlane pipeline first. Any change here requires a security sign-off since limits gate the admin endpoints. Current enforced values are as follows.

deployment values, yadup-kadug:
[sorys]
port = 5672
team = noveth
host = sorys.orvexcorp.example
region = south-4
access_code = ac_deddc1
timeout_ms = 1500